about summ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--ChangeLog4
-rw-r--r--nscd/netgroupcache.c4
2 files changed, 6 insertions, 2 deletions
diff --git a/ChangeLog b/ChangeLog
index 32a6a5dafd..755ca1d99f 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,7 @@
+2011-10-17  Ulrich Drepper  <drepper@gmail.com>
+
+	* nscd/netgroupcache.c (addgetnetgrentX): Fix #ifdef nesting.
+
 2011-10-17  Andreas Schwab  <schwab@redhat.com>
 
 	* misc/sys/cdefs.h: Fix last change.
diff --git a/nscd/netgroupcache.c b/nscd/netgroupcache.c
index a406ade995..02cda13644 100644
--- a/nscd/netgroupcache.c
+++ b/nscd/netgroupcache.c
@@ -406,10 +406,10 @@ addgetnetgrentX (struct database_dyn *db, int fd, request_header *req,
 # endif
 	}
       else
+#endif
 	{
-# ifndef __ASSUME_SENDFILE
+#if defined HAVE_SENDFILE && !defined __ASSUME_SENDFILE
 	use_write:
-# endif
 #endif
 	  writeall (fd, &dataset->resp, dataset->head.recsize);
 	}